Working Principles

The UCC28220PW operates as a voltage mode PWM controller, regulating the output voltage by adjusting the duty cycle of the power MOSFET. It compares the feedback voltage (FB) with a reference voltage to generate an error signal. This error signal is then processed to control the duty cycle and maintain the desired output voltage. The controller also incorporates protection features such as overvoltage and overcurrent protection to ensure safe operation.
